Welcome to the Brindlewood Systems platform team. Our services use PgBouncer-style connection pooling through an internal library called Poolhouse. Each service gets a fixed pool of 20 connections; do not raise this without approval from the platform lead. Long-running transactions will exhaust the pool quickly, so keep queries short. For local development and staging work, connect to the staging pool using the connection string below.

primary connection of yagep-kahip = redis://giliel_svc:zYiKsLL2PLpfPL@db-348f.xolmarsys.corp:5432/fenwyn

TICKET PV-2231 — Feedcheck validator creds expired

The Feedcheck podcast validator stopped polling Saturday. Root cause: its credential for the Ostram metadata service lapsed; nobody renewed after Hal rotated the batch last month. All feed health checks have been silently green-stale since then. Fix is trivial but needs sign-off at sync. Short-term: I've minted a replacement credential with a 90-day expiry and flagged it for the renewal calendar. For the record, the new key is as follows.

API key for yahig-tadup: kto7_ubizbYm

BRIEFING — Leadership Review, distribution: branch managers only

Subject: Possible acquisition of Thornquist Fabrication by Delvaney Metals Group.

Status: early diligence. Thornquist brings two plants in the Harrow Basin, a solid mid-market client book, and aging press equipment. Valuation gap remains; their board wants a premium we consider unjustified. Integration risk is moderate, mainly scheduling software and union terms. Decision point: next leadership review. No external discussion. The confidential note on our plans appears below.

confidential, yahip-hagug: Gorixax Logistics plans to lower the Ulaael list price by 26.6 percent in October. The pricing group signed off on a budget of $199.9 million for Project Holix. The renewal with Kasdorox Systems closes at $137.5 million a year, 8.2 percent above the last contract. Project Lamion slips by a full year because of the audit delay.